Summary/Abstract: The Authoress presents the idea of education in the thought of Antonio Rosmini Serbati. He was one of the most outstanding Italian thinkers of XIX century, and thanks to the universalism of his doctrine – also the key-figure of modern philosophy. The literary output of Rosmini referred to many spheres of human live. Education took a special place in his thought because of his interest in the improvement of man, as well as his engagement into educational activity. His interest in education was originated already in first years of his grammar-school (1808-1814), and lasted until his death (1855). It was the effect of the maturity of his mind, his cultural and scientific formation, and also “a sign of times.”
